Walter Montillo is a 41-year-old football player who plays as a attacking midfielder, born on 14 april 1984, who is right-footed. Follow Walter Montillo on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2020 Primera Division season, Walter Montillo has recorded 4 goals, 8 assists, 2 255 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.09, 1 yellow card.

Walter Montillo scores highly on Assists, Matches, and Rating compared to attacking midfielders in the Primera Division.

Walter Montillo's career has also included time at Universidad de Chile, Tigre, Botafogo RJ, Shandong Taishan, Santos FC, Cruzeiro, San Lorenzo, and Atletico Morelia.

On the international stage, Walter Montillo has represented Argentina.

Throughout their career, Walter Montillo has won 6 titles: Primera División (2009 Apertura) with Universidad de Chile, Copa de la Superliga (2019) with Tigre, Super Cup (2015) and FA Cup (2014) with Shandong Taishan, Mineiro 1 (2011) with Cruzeiro, and CONMEBOL Sudamericana (2002) with San Lorenzo.
